About this experience

Immerse yourself in the beauty of Akaroa on this private day trip from Christchurch. Enjoy a scenic drive across Banks Peninsula, taking in stunning coastal views and stopping for photos along the way. Once in Akaroa, spend two hours exploring the charming village, with its local boutiques and galleries. Savor a leisurely 90-minute lunch at a waterfront restaurant, followed by a 1.5-hour guided harbour cruise where you can spot Hector’s dolphins, seals, and seabirds (fees are not included). What you'll see and do

  1. Little River

    Little River is a charming, rural settlement nestled in a valley at the gateway to the Banks Peninsula. It is a convenient stopover roughly a 45-minute drive from Christchurch and 30 minutes from Akaroa. Known for its scenic beauty, art, and classic Kiwi charm, there is plenty to do and see in the area.

    60 minutes here

  2. Akaroa

    Akaroa is a historic seaside town nestled in the crater of an extinct volcano on the Banks Peninsula. Located just a spectacular 85 km (1.5 hours) drive southeast of Christchurch, it is famous for its distinct French heritage, rare marine wildlife, and scenic coastal beauty.

    180 minutes here
